The British pound fell against the US dollar on Wednesday, amid hopes over the US economic recovery from the coronavirus pandemic.
US Federal Reserve Chairman Jerome Powell stated recently that the pace of economic recovery has moderated in recent months, but added that the economy would recover in tandem with vaccination.
Pfizer announced that its Covid-19 vaccine showed effectiveness against the new strains in lab trails.
As of 20:57 GMT, GBP/USD rose 0.2% to 1.3636, after hitting a high of 1.3683, and a low of 1.3620.
